What is the Ruling if Both Feet are Lifted off the Ground in Sajdah?

Question:

What happens if both feet lift up during sajdah, (however not as long as three tabīiḥ)? If it is as long as three tasbīḥ then how is it?

Answer:

If both feet remained totally lifted from the ground for less than three (3) tasbīḥ, then he placed the toes of both or one foot (on the ground) then the ṣalāh is valid. If they (both feet) remained totally lifted (off the ground) for three (3) tasbīḥ, then the ṣalāh is not valid.

Fatāwā Maḥmūdiyah Vol.11 Pg.80 Tartīb Jadīd


Tasbīḥ means saying Suḥānallāh سبحان الله

A similar fatwā was given by:

1. Ḥazrat Maulānā Yūsuf Ludhyānvī Sāhib in Āp ke Masā’il aur Unkā Ḥal (Vol.3 Pg.558-559),

2. Ḥazrat Muftī Shabbīr Ahmad Qāsmī in Fatāwā Qāsmiyah (Vol.7 Pg.486-487)

3. Ḥazrat Muftī Salmān Mansūrpūrī in Kitābun Nawāzil (Vol.4 Pg.146).
